Bullfighting Festival in Cheongdo

March 9  ~  March 17,  2002

Cheongdo Bullfighting has developed over the years from a dangerously amusing and recreational event to an exciting competition. Today the event features bulls pitted against other bulls in three weight divisions and awarded prizes for their skills in overcoming the opponent. The Cheongdo region is famous for this increasingly popular traditional event, now having crossed international borders with the Korea-Japan Goodwill Bullfighting Match and incorporated some elements of rodeo-style games for more international appeal. Absent from Cheongdo Bullfighting is the graphic violence of the sport depicted elsewhere, without compromising the realism or thrill of watching the raging bulls. In this event, the animals are not killed or seriously injured.

Main Events
Bullfighting tournament classified by weight, Korea-Japan goodwill bullfighting match, Korean bull rodeo, Cheong-do bullfighting photograph contest and exhibition, bull show
